A Day in the Life of a Personal Trainer
Photos and Writing by Lauren LeMaster
In this photo essay I captured the life of a personal trainer, that is also a full time student. The personal trainer, Hannah, works as a certified trainer at a gym that her parents own in her hometown. She wanted to keep in practice with her certification, and make some extra money, so she continued to work and take on clients here at Washington State. She has a very busy schedule, she has to work out on her own time to stay in shape, train her clients, attend classes, and keep up with homework. Before she meets with her clients she makes a personalized workout for whoever she is training that day. In this photo essay, she is working shoulders with her client Tabitha. I am trying to show the amount of pressure that is on personal trainers to keep up with normal day to day things, as well as the pressure that is on them to have an ‘ideal body’ that will get them clients and at the same time give their clients assurance for a certain body image.
